Abstract
This paper proposes a method to guarantee bandwidth or latency of network-on-chip. Compared with circuit-switch method, this method can guarantee the latency between one flitpsilas generation and its reception and support a wide range of traffic types. Also, a maximum latency formula is developed. Results show that this method guarantees the bandwidth and latency well and is low-cost.
